Air Buster: Trouble Specialty Raid Unit is a 1990 arcade shoot-'em-up by Kaneko. It was ported to a variety of home consoles such as the Sega Mega Drive; this port was released in 1991 exclusively in Japan, where it was renamed Aero Blasters: Trouble Specialty Raid Unit (エアロブラスターズ), and the US.

B shoots; there is rapidfire and some powerups depend on it. A shoots a single shot. Holding A charges a flash attack which damages everything on screen. Once it is fully charged, let go of A to perform the attack; you must then wait for the charge bar to empty (it will show you a black bar telling you how much time you must wait) before you can charge another. Powerups are collected by destroying barrels scattered throughout each level.
